在这个信息爆炸的时代,数据库迁移已经成为企业数字化转型的重要一环。无论是系统升级、业务扩展还是迁移到云平台,选择一款高效的数据迁移工具至关重要。以下是针对SQL数据库的5款热门迁移工具的评测指南,帮助你找到最适合你需求的解决方案。
1. Navicat Premium
特点: Navicat Premium是一款集成了多种数据库管理功能的工具,支持MySQL、MariaDB、SQL Server、Oracle、PostgreSQL、SQLite等多种数据库。
优点:
- 用户界面友好:操作直观,即使是数据库新手也能快速上手。
- 批量操作:支持批量迁移、导出、导入操作,提高工作效率。
- 数据同步:支持实时同步数据,确保迁移过程中的数据一致性。
缺点:
- 价格较高:对于小型企业或个人用户来说,价格可能是一个障碍。
- 免费版功能有限:免费版仅支持迁移到MySQL数据库。
适用场景: 适合各类企业和个人用户进行数据库迁移。
2. SQL Server Management Studio (SSMS)
特点: SSMS是微软官方提供的SQL Server数据库管理工具,集成了数据迁移、数据库备份、性能监控等功能。
优点:
- 官方支持:性能稳定,兼容性好。
- 集成度高:与SQL Server紧密集成,支持多种迁移任务。
- 免费使用:无需额外费用。
缺点:
- 操作复杂:对于不熟悉SQL Server的用户来说,学习曲线较陡峭。
- 迁移范围有限:主要针对SQL Server数据库。
适用场景: 适合已使用SQL Server数据库的用户进行迁移。
3. AWS Database Migration Service (DMS)
特点: AWS DMS是亚马逊云服务提供的一款数据库迁移工具,支持MySQL、PostgreSQL、SQL Server、Oracle等数据库。
优点:
- 云服务支持:易于部署和管理,无需额外硬件。
- 无缝迁移:支持在线迁移,不会影响现有业务。
- 高可用性:提供自动备份和故障恢复机制。
缺点:
- 价格昂贵:对于小型企业来说,成本可能较高。
- 迁移限制:迁移过程中可能会遇到兼容性问题。
适用场景: 适合云计算环境下的数据库迁移。
4. Oracle GoldenGate
特点: Oracle GoldenGate是一款高性能的数据迁移、复制和同步工具,支持多种数据库。
优点:
- 高效率:支持实时迁移,几乎不会影响源数据库性能。
- 高可靠性:提供数据校验和恢复机制,确保数据完整性。
- 灵活配置:支持多种迁移模式,满足不同业务需求。
缺点:
- 成本较高:对于中小企业来说,价格可能是一个负担。
- 技术门槛:需要专业的技术团队进行操作。
适用场景: 适合对数据迁移性能和可靠性要求较高的企业。
5. Talend Open Studio
特点: Talend Open Studio是一款数据集成平台,支持多种数据源和目标,包括SQL数据库。
优点:
- 功能丰富:除了数据迁移,还支持数据清洗、转换、加载等操作。
- 可视化操作:通过拖拽方式配置数据流,降低学习成本。
- 支持多种数据源:兼容性良好,支持各种数据库和文件系统。
缺点:
- 操作复杂:对于不熟悉数据集成的用户来说,可能需要一段时间学习。
- 免费版功能有限:免费版只支持有限的数据源和目标。
适用场景: 适合需要进行复杂数据集成的企业。
总结来说,选择合适的SQL数据迁移工具需要根据实际需求和预算进行权衡。以上5款工具各有优缺点,希望本文的评测指南能帮助你找到最适合你的解决方案。
